DAKAR SUMMIT DETERMINES METHYL BROMIDE'S FUTURE
 
Meeting in Dakar, Senegal, the Parties to the Montreal Protocol on Substances that Deplete the Ozone Layer agreed Friday (December 16) on a total volume of methyl bromide critical use exemptions (CUEs) for 2007 of 7,466 tonnes, down 45 percent from 2006 amounts.
 
Dan Botts, FFVA's director, Environmental and Pest Management Division, traveled to Dakar to represent Florida growers in the high-level, international environmental talks.
 
Botts was among those fighting for the CUEs, which would allow growers continued access to the fumigant for uses where no feasible alternatives are available.
